The Wren is an oversized crewneck sweatshirt with a large exaggerated shoulder yoke. Volumenous, slightly cropped sleeves are created by a deep box pleat at the opening. The neckband and cuffs were created with self fabric in mind but this quick and easy make also works well with ribbing.

FABRIC RECOMMENDATION

For best results choose a knit fabric with minimum 15% stretch in circumference; fleece/ponte/double knit. Or try a stretch woven with similar minimum stretch. However, we believe you can make everything out of anything, feel free to contact us for advice if you’re feeling adventurous.

SIZE & FIT

This pattern is available in 2 size ranges; DD XS-XXL and JJ 1X-5X

Kaya is wearing a size XS from the DD size range in a rayon stretch woven with cotton ribbing neckband and collar. Her measurements are; 33"/27"/36 1/2" at 5'2"

Franki is wearing a size XXL from the DD size range in a 280gsm cotton fleece. Their measurements are; 46 1/2"/39"/50" at 5'9"

    I sized down from my size on the size chart, and really liked the fit. I did add length (I'm 5'8") to the sleeves (1") and body (1"), and removed width from the cuff (1 1/2"). I color blocked it; it has the perfect style lines to do it with. I used sweatshirt fleece at about 10 oz, so it wasn't thin, but also wasn't structured. Instructions were good and the pattern pieces came together well. I didn't see a hem measurement suggested? I turned mine 3/4".
